In her fictionalized journal, elevenyearold Minnie Swift recounts how her family dealt with the difficult times during the Depression and how an orphan from Texas changed their lives in Indianapolis just before Christmas 1932.

- Q: What is the main theme of 'Christmas After All'? A: 'Christmas After All' explores the challenges faced by families during the Great Depression through the eyes of eleven-year-old Minnie Swift. The story highlights resilience, family bonds, and the impact of kindness, particularly through the arrival of an orphan from Texas.
- Q: Who is the author of this book? A: The book is authored by Kathryn Lasky, known for her engaging storytelling aimed at younger audiences.
- Q: What age group is this book suitable for? A: 'Christmas After All' is suitable for children and pre-teens, particularly those aged 8 to 12, as it is part of the Dear America series designed for young readers.
- Q: Is this book a true story? A: While 'Christmas After All' is a fictionalized account, it is set against the historical backdrop of the Great Depression and reflects the real experiences of families during that era.

- Q: Is this book part of a series? A: 'Christmas After All' is part of the Dear America series, which features fictional diaries of girls living in various historical periods, providing insights into their lives and times.
